  • October 14, 1989AccidentHull loss

    On final approach to Dhahran Airport, the twin engine aircraft lost height and crashed on the top of a hill located few km from the airfield. The aircraft was destroyed and all five occupants were killed. Probable cause (official findings): The assumption that the loss of control was the consequence of an engine failure was not ruled out.

    BAe Jetstream 31 · 5 fatalities
